Diego Noriega is a pre-seed investor at Newtopia VC focused on FinTech and E-Commerce. Diego Noriega is currently the managing partner of Newtopia, an investment fund for seed and pre-seed stage startups. Before becoming an investor, Diego co-founded more than 23 successful companies, including AlaMaula, which eBay acquired. Drawing on his strong business development skills and knowledge, he has mentored more than 1200 startups,evaluated more than 2000 companies for investment, and delivered about 250 conferences on business development and entrepreneurship.In his current role as Managing Partner at Newtopia, he is responsible for building the Newtopia community and supporting the teams through extensive mentoring programs. The goal of Newtopia is to fund the most outstanding Latin American entrepreneurial talent and guide them on their path to global markets.In his own words: "My purpose in life is to change Latin America. Supporting entrepreneurs is the best tool I know, and that’s why I want to impact +1,000,000 entrepreneurs in the next ten years".

Pulppo is the first Tech Enabled broker for Latin America. We partner with the best brokers in the region and empower them with tools, technology and resources to create a simple and transparent buying process. Pulppo was founded by Agustin Iglesias, former GM of Inmuebles24 and founder of Tokko Broker (Acquired by Navent) and Matias Gath, formerGM of Glovo in Argentina and founder of Kadabra (acquired by Glovo). | $1.7M / Pre-Seed / Feb 01, 2022 | |

Nuqlea is a B2B digital platform for construction and habitat that integrates and digitizes its entire value chain and develops useful techonological solutions through its marketplace. With the purpose of transforming the industry, Nuqlea seeks to offer transparency, efficiency and traceability in terms of purchasing processes, costs and shipments. | $3.9M / Seed / Oct 01, 2021 | |

About Newtopia VC
Newtopia VC is a venture capital firm that targeted early-stage startups. Newtopia’s launch comes as global venture investors are increasingly backing Latin American startups. The region now has at least 23 unicorn startups.
